Initial Test Results
This has great potential when the FPS are more in line with local game performance.
This has great potential when smaller less demanding and better routes are accessible which may improve FPS. Not a huge fan of Port Ogden, but it is being used due to it is so large of a map and understand the logic why it was used as a Beta Test Map.
The turnout lock feature is somewhat an issue as seems sometimes with low FPS it is hard to change.
The equipment defect detector (which is not fully active or fully scripted ) is pretty sweet.
That's about it for my findings. Hope the FPS and Netwrok Data Transfer is fixed ASAP.
- Port Ogden playing locally not in MP - 48FPS; In MP 15FPS :'(
- Driver leaves session and consist does not reset to default location ( had two blockages due to unassigned consists )
- Network Data transfer needs refined and compressed for better efficiency. Consists sometimes abruptly appear, and slow signal changes causing opportunity of conflicts. Other issues also realized by me as described by JadeBullet and feel it is the network data transfer needing additional work / effeciencies.
- If you choose to focus on a particular individual in the dialog box, the only way to obtain your claimed consist I could figure out is scrolling to the past in the dialog box where it notes you claimed a particular consist.
- May I repeat: Horrible FPS in MP and not in the same local game environment (potentially ruining this as a great feature).
- Had to adjust firewall quite often to figure out why my latency was so high preventing me to connect and then defaulting to setting up my own server but with loss of internet connection following the latency rejection.
- When exiting MP and returning to the main interface screen whereas now the update section states if you are online or not, I found I was disconnected. Only way to obtain the connection was an exit/enter strategy to the game
